    Regarding the issue itself, as a first step can you try to uninstall and reinstall the app to see if that gets things working again (don't worry, your data is stored in a separate location and is safe):

    1. Quit all open web browsers.
    2. If you see the 1Password menubar icon in the top right corner of your screen then right-click on it and click Quit.
    3. Drag 1Password from the Applications folder to the Trash. Do not use an "app cleaner" or "uninstaller" tool to remove the app or additional files. If prompted, enter the password you use to sign in to your Mac.
    4. Restart your Mac.
    5. Download the latest version of 1Password from the 1Password website.
    6. Quit any open web browsers and then install 1Password.
    7. Open and unlock 1Password before opening your web browser.
